Those numbers are usually an "all in" price. Not just the firearm, but extra mags for the officers, more extra mags for the armorers, armorer's class, spare parts, and sometimes even new holsters.

NYPD Officers pay for their equipment- to the extent now when recruits are required to pay for night sights (mandatory) on their provided pistol. NYPD Officers are required to purchase most of their equipment....That recruits are provided with a their first duty pistol is a sort of break from tradition that originated following enactment of the crime bill.
